Towards Health of Replication in Large-Scale P2P-VoD Systems

Haitao Li,Xu Ke,James Seng,Po Hu
DOI: https://doi.org/10.1109/pccc.2009.5403807
2009-01-01
Abstract:Unlike P2P-based live streaming, P2P-based video-on-demand (P2P-VoD) has asynchrony in sharing video content among users. To compensate, each peer is expected to contribute a fixed amount of disk space, which forms a distributed P2P storage system. How to regulate this storage system is undoubtedly one of the most important strategies in P2P-VoD systems. PPLive, a large-scale P2P-VoD system, has made great efforts to optimize replication by improving file replacement algorithm, since developed in the fall of 2007. In this paper, we introduce the replacement algorithms PPLive takes and compare their performance when the user request patterns are in a steady state and when they change sharply. These real-world experiences will provide valuable insights into what a healthy replication is and the future design of replication strategy.
What problem does this paper attempt to address?